Relating to transportation; appropriating money to the commissioner of transportation (DOT) for state road construction to be allocated to state construction districts using the target allocation formula, for local bridge replacement and rehabilitation, for transfer to the local road improvement fund and the county turnback account and for port development assistance grants, to the metropolitan council for construction of bus garages and transit ways, for purchases of buses and capital facilities and for fare increase replacement and to the commissioner of finance for transfer to the transportation revolving fund; specifying certain commissioner of transportation project cancellation or delay and status reporting requirements; creating a local road improvement fund, requiring the commissioner to appoint a local road improvement advisory committee for consultation on criteria for expenditures and allocations from the fund, specifying certain membership representation requirements; establishing the trunk highway corridor, local road development, small cities and noise wall accounts in the fund; requiring money in the trunk highway corridor account to be used for grants to cities, towns and counties for the local share of projects involving the reconstruction or improvement of trunk highways, money in the local road development account for grants to cities and counties for the costs of constructing or reconstructing local roads in the municipal or county state aid systems, money in the small cities account for grants to certain small cities for costs relating to maintenance and construction of local road systems and money in the noise wall account for grants to cities, towns and counties for the cost of constructing noise walls along trunk highways (je)
